Latest Patents
Karim's most recent patents focus on innovative techniques for wireless charging. The first patent, titled "Wireless Power Repeating," describes advanced methods for wireless charging, utilizing a system that comprises a wireless power receiving coil that connects to a wireless charger. This design includes a second transmitting coil that propagates current, thus creating a magnetic field to facilitate power delivery.
The second patent, "Apparatus, System and Method of Wireless Power Transfer," outlines a Wireless Power Receiver (WPR) that incorporates a rectifier for converting a received wireless charging signal into Direct Current (DC) power. It features a voltage regulator to manage the voltage level, a bypass path to streamline the power flow, and a bypass controller that intelligently directs the power according to its voltage characteristics.
